Popular Standing Desk Types You Might Find
When exploring standing desks, you’ll encounter several common categories, each catering to different preferences and budgets. While Costco’s inventory can vary, here are the primary types and how they typically align with available models:
- Manual Height Adjustable Standing Desks: These desks rely on a hand crank or spring-loaded mechanism to adjust height. They are generally the most affordable but require physical effort and offer slower transitions. You’re less likely to find these as full desks at Costco, which tends to favor motorized options, but desk risers might fall into this category.
- Electric Height Adjustable Standing Desks: These are the most common and sought-after, featuring electric motors for smooth, quick, and effortless height changes. Many come with programmable memory presets, allowing you to save your preferred sitting and standing heights. Costco prominently features electric models, such as the Tresanti series, due to their ease of use and modern functionality.
- Standing Desk Converters/Risers: Instead of replacing your entire desk, these devices sit on top of your existing workstation, lifting your monitors and keyboard to a standing height. They are a cost-effective solution for those who want the benefits of a standing desk without a full furniture overhaul. Costco occasionally stocks popular risers like the ApexDesk ZT.
- Folding Standing Desks: Designed for portability and space-saving, these desks can be easily folded and stored when not in use. They are less common as full-featured electric standing desks but might appear in simpler, more compact designs.
- Treadmill or Bike Desks: These integrated workstations allow you to walk or cycle gently while working. They offer maximum physical activity but require significant space and investment. These are generally not standard offerings at Costco.
Costco’s selection primarily focuses on electric height-adjustable standing desks, offering a blend of features and value that appeals to a broad audience looking for a convenient and efficient upgrade.

Height Adjustment Range
The desk’s height range is paramount for ergonomic comfort. It should comfortably accommodate your height both when sitting and standing. For sitting, your elbows should form a 90-degree angle with your forearms parallel to the floor. When standing, the same principle applies. Check the minimum and maximum height specifications. Some Costco models might have a slightly higher minimum height, which could be a concern for shorter individuals, while taller users should confirm the maximum height is sufficient.
Material and Durability
The materials used for the desktop and frame contribute to both aesthetics and durability. Many Costco standing desks, particularly the Tresanti, feature a tempered glass top. This offers a sleek, modern look and is often dry-erase compatible, which can be a fun and functional feature. However, glass tops can show fingerprints and smudges more readily and may require a mouse pad. The frame is typically steel or aluminum, providing a sturdy foundation. Assess the overall build quality to ensure it can withstand daily use.

Can I use a monitor arm with a glass-top standing desk from Costco?
Using a monitor arm with a glass-top desk, like many Tresanti models, requires caution. While the tempered glass is strong, clamping a monitor arm directly to the edge can put undue stress on the glass, potentially leading to cracks. It’s generally recommended to use a freestanding monitor stand or a clamp that distributes weight over a wider surface area (e.g., with protective pads), or to opt for a desk with a different desktop material if a clamped monitor arm is essential for your setup.
